What are some of Maya Angelou's most inspiring quotes for women?
Many of Angelou's quotes directly address the struggles and triumphs of women. Here are a few examples of how her words can foster positive thinking:
"Nothing can dim the light which shines from within."
This quote encapsulates the inherent strength and resilience within every woman. It's a powerful reminder that inner strength is an invaluable resource, unaffected by external circumstances. It encourages women to tap into their inner light, their unique talents and passions, regardless of societal expectations or setbacks.
"I've learned that people will forget what you said, people will forget what you did, but people will never forget how you made them feel."
This quote highlights the importance of kindness, empathy, and positive interactions. It encourages women to focus on creating positive connections and leaving a lasting positive impact on the world around them, fostering a more supportive and nurturing environment.
"Try to be a rainbow in someone's cloud."
Angelou's call to be a source of hope and positivity emphasizes the ripple effect of kindness. By choosing to radiate positivity, women can inspire others and contribute to a more uplifting collective experience. This emphasizes the power of positive action and its transformative potential.
"If you don't like something, change it. If you can't change it, change your attitude."
This is a practical application of positive thinking. It encourages proactive problem-solving while also emphasizing the importance of perspective. When faced with an unchangeable situation, adopting a positive attitude can significantly improve one's well-being and ability to cope.
How can women apply Maya Angelou's wisdom to their daily lives?
Applying Angelou's wisdom isn't about memorizing quotes; it's about internalizing the messages of self-love, resilience, and empowerment. This involves:
- Practicing self-compassion: Acknowledge your strengths and weaknesses with kindness and understanding.
- Cultivating gratitude: Focus on the positive aspects of your life, big and small.
- Setting realistic goals: Break down large goals into smaller, manageable steps.
- Surrounding yourself with positive influences: Spend time with people who uplift and support you.
- Speaking positively to yourself: Replace negative self-talk with affirmations and positive self-encouragement.
